About Converting Drams per Quart to Pounds per Cubic yard
Dram per Quart and Pound per Cubic yard both measure density — mass per unit volume — a property used to identify materials, check manufacturing quality, and predict whether something floats or sinks. As a fixed reference point, water has a density of exactly 1000 kg/m³ (1 g/cm³, 1 g/mL) at its temperature of maximum density, which is why many density figures in science and engineering are quoted relative to water. Both are mass per volume density units.
Formula
pounds per cubic yard = drams per quart × 3.15584415584
This factor comes from each unit's defined relationship to the category's base unit: 1 dram per quart equals 1.87228792683 base units, and 1 pound per cubic yard equals 0.593276421258 base units, so dividing one by the other gives the direct dram per quart-to-pound per cubic yard factor of 3.15584415584.

What's the difference between density and mass concentration?
Density is the mass of a pure substance or material per unit volume. Mass concentration is the mass of one component — like a dissolved solute — within a mixture's total volume. The two use the same kind of units but describe different physical situations.
